Agrar Terminal Peter Rothe, a prominent player in the agribusiness sector, is headquartered in Germany and operates extensively across various regions in Europe. Founded in 1992, the company has established itself as a leader in the handling and trading of agricultural commodities, particularly grains and oilseeds. With a commitment to quality and efficiency, Agrar Terminal Peter Rothe offers a range of services including storage, logistics, and trading solutions tailored to meet the needs of farmers and businesses alike. Agrar Terminal Peter Rothe currently does not have available carbon emissions data, as no specific figures have been provided. Consequently, there are no reported emissions for the most recent year or any previous years, including Scope 1, 2, or 3 emissions. In the absence of concrete emissions data, it is important to note that Agrar Terminal Peter Rothe has not outlined any specific reduction targets or climate commitments.
